i was annoyed by how my previous xurk team was basically completely invalidated by ev limit removal not to mention innards out ban so i wanted to make a new one. started with the best xurk set in my opinion which is galvanize specs, beats up fat balance teams because outside imposter they can rarely switch into it.
now when i used xurk before, something that really annoyed me was when your opponent had something that could switch into boomburst and didn't just die to coverage like zyg. talking things like giratina and av regen grounds. for this i added illusion kyurem-w but it turns out that illusion kyurem-w is terrible; it doesn't ohko giratina with even specs ice beam and it offers like no defensive utility. illusion rayquaza is a much better choice here because in addition to a better defensive typing it also has a useful stab oblivion wing to preserve illusion even if it gets hit.
with imposter-proofing, the more obscure the mon is, the better. mega audino with soundproof, despite not offering any resistances, checks imposters of both xurk and rayquaza simply due to its fantastic special bulk and boomburst immunity.
every team needs prankster haze unless it's hyper offense so i decided to make my user zyg-c. in addition to beating up most shell smashers and eating their hits zygarde is also a very effective check to ph users such as regigigas and kyogre due to its incredible bulk.
every bh team also needs a steel. registeel was a good choice for a while because of its bulk, but it sometimes couldn't keep up with coverage moves from ate users. solgaleo was my choice eventually because it could threaten these mons back with sunsteel strike.
last but not least my team needed something to not get 6-0'd by contrary so here is imposter chansey. in addition to this it's also a great check to things like cb don which threaten to ohko zyg on the switch.
電嘨 (Xurkitree) @ Choice Specs
Ability: Galvanize
EVs: 252 HP / 252 Def / 252 SpA / 252 SpD / 252 Spe
Modest Nature
IVs: 0 Atk
- Boomburst
- Ice Beam
- Earth Power
- Leech Seed
here is the main breaker of the team. everything has 252/252 bulk so it kills less things now, but the increased bulk is also pretty big for it allowing it to take on mons like primal kyogre. the moves are pretty straightforward: boomburst for stab, ice beam to smack fat dragons, earth power for guys like mlix and pdon on the switch. seeds is the best last move on this set because it keeps the illusion trick alive while wearing down imposters much more easily (and, importantly, denying them recovery of their own).
瞹龍 (Rayquaza-Mega) @ Choice Specs
Ability: Illusion
EVs: 252 HP / 252 Atk / 252 Def / 252 SpA / 252 SpD / 252 Spe
Timid Nature
- Draco Meteor
- Oblivion Wing
- Knock Off
- Moongeist Beam
here's illusion rayquaza the other mon in the core. draco meteor just shreds giratina, the typical xurk switchin, while knockoff helps against stuff like avregen and chansey that try to switch in. moongeist is for shed because shed is dumb lol
癒し妖精 (Audino-Mega) @ Safety Goggles
Ability: Soundproof
EVs: 252 HP / 252 Atk / 252 Def / 252 SpA / 252 SpD
Relaxed Nature
IVs: 0 Spe
- Roost
- U-turn
- Core Enforcer
- Defog
soundproof audino helps deal with xurkitree imposters while also having a great matchup against rayquaza. most sets are either aerilate or triage; aerilate boomburst just bounces off while you can u-turn to audino on a triage tail glow. defog is a form of hazard removal that can't be blocked.
大地守り (Zygarde-Complete) @ Safety Goggles
Ability: Prankster
EVs: 252 HP / 252 Atk / 252 Def / 252 SpA / 252 SpD
Relaxed Nature
IVs: 0 Spe
- Core Enforcer
- Haze
- Shore Up
- U-turn
prankster haze zyggy helps against not only aps users such as ttar, but it also checks ph mons like regi and ogre. stab core enforcer is really nice and safety goggles prevent opponents from sporing it. originally i used icium z to improve assistdons matchup but i got haxed by spore regi so i changed to goggles.
鍛接獅 (Solgaleo) @ Assault Vest
Ability: Regenerator
EVs: 252 HP / 252 Atk / 252 Def / 252 SpA / 252 SpD / 252 Spe
Jolly Nature
- Rapid Spin
- U-turn
- Sunsteel Strike
- Revelation Dance
here's av regen solgaleo, my check for -ates and psychics. sunsteel strike beats up fairies such as ph xern while revelation dance is a lure for normalize gengar. i didn't include any crippling moves such as nuzzle because i wanted to easily be able to play around imposter. rapid spin is hazard removal #2 which is really nice to take pressure off audino.
soulja boi (Chansey) (M) @ Eviolite
Ability: Imposter
EVs: 252 HP / 252 Atk / 252 Def / 252 SpA / 252 SpD / 252 Spe
Impish Nature
- Fake Out
- Soft-Boiled
- Final Gambit
- Whirlwind
imposter chansey is the ultimate glue mon. it can switch into most ates and random threatening offensive guys like mmy. additionally, it's the team's main check for contrary-- ideally, another mon will take the first hit, then u-turn into chansey to break the sash. final gambit is pretty lit because you can use it in case an opposing imposter is out of control.
